Destroy orphan objects

Murano has a garbage collector that destroys objects
which were deleted in API after last deployment.
However if objects were removed from object model
during deployment (action execution) or were created
and not saved there they left unnoticed by the engine
causing resource leak.

With this change all objects that are presented in object store
but were not serialized to result object model are get destroyed.
